
Understanding circular saw amperage is crucial for selecting the right tool for your projects. Generally, a circular saw with 10-12 amps is sufficient for most DIY tasks involving wood and softer materials, while 13-15 amps are recommended for tougher materials like hardwoods, pressure-treated lumber, and occasional light metal cutting. Professional contractors often opt for 15-amp saws for their consistent power and durability.
Why Amperage Matters for Circular Saws
Amperage directly correlates with the power output of a corded circular saw. Higher amperage means more power, which translates to the saw’s ability to cut through denser materials without bogging down or overheating. This is especially important when making long cuts or working with thick stock, as a underpowered saw can lead to frustration, poor cut quality, and even kickback.
For cordless circular saws, voltage (e.g., 18V, 20V) is the primary indicator of power, though some manufacturers also list amp-hour (Ah) ratings for battery capacity, which affects run time. When comparing corded models, always look at the amp rating to gauge its cutting capability.
Recommended Amperage for Common Materials
The type of material you’re cutting will dictate the minimum amperage required for efficient and safe operation. Here’s a breakdown:
- Softwoods (Pine, Spruce, Fir): 10-12 amps are generally adequate. These saws are lighter and easier to handle for basic framing or trim work.
- Hardwoods (Oak, Maple, Cherry): 13-15 amps are highly recommended. The extra power prevents the blade from binding and ensures cleaner cuts.
- Plywood, OSB, MDF: 12-14 amps will handle most sheet goods effectively. Consider a higher amp model for thicker sheets or repetitive cuts.
- Pressure-Treated Lumber: 14-15 amps are ideal due to the density and moisture content of this material.
- Plastics and Composites: 10-13 amps are usually sufficient, but blade choice is equally important here.
Always match your saw’s power to the task at hand to avoid straining the motor and to achieve the best results.
Impact of Amperage on Performance and Durability
A circular saw with appropriate amperage for its intended use will perform better and last longer. An underpowered saw constantly working at its limit will generate more heat, leading to premature motor wear and potential failure. Conversely, a saw with ample power will cut more smoothly, reduce user fatigue, and maintain its performance over time.
Consider the frequency of use as well. If you’re a casual DIYer making occasional cuts, a 10-12 amp saw might suffice. However, for regular use or more demanding projects, investing in a 13-15 amp model is a wise decision for its longevity and versatility.
Choosing the Right Amperage for Your Needs
When selecting a circular saw, think about your typical projects. If you primarily work with thinner softwoods for crafts or small repairs, a lower amperage model will be more than capable. For those tackling home renovations, deck building, or working with a variety of materials, a higher amperage saw will offer the necessary power and flexibility.
Don’t just focus on the highest number; consider the balance between power, weight, and features. A 15-amp saw might be overkill and heavier for someone who only cuts thin plywood. Always read reviews and compare specifications to find the best fit for your specific requirements.
Safety Considerations with Circular Saw Amperage
While higher amperage means more power, it also means the saw can generate more torque. This makes proper technique and safety precautions even more critical. Always ensure your blade is sharp and appropriate for the material, and maintain a firm grip on the saw. Overloading a circuit with a high-amperage saw can also be a hazard, so be mindful of your power source and extension cord ratings.
Never force a saw through material, regardless of its amperage. Let the blade do the work. If the saw is struggling, it could indicate an issue with the blade, the material, or that the saw is simply not powerful enough for the task.
